16. Guidelines

This device complies with EU Medical Devices Directive 93/42/EEC, the German Medical
Devices Act (Medizinproduktegesetz), the ASTM (American Society for Testing and Mate-
rials) E 1965 - 98 and the European Standard EN60601-1-2 (in accordance with CISPR11,
IEC 61000-4-2, IEC 61000-4-3, IEC 61000-4-8) and is subject to particular precautions with
regard to electromagnetic compatibility.
Notes on electromagnetic compatibility
• The device is suitable for use in all environments listed in these instructions for use, includ-
ing domestic environments.
• The use of the device may be limited in the presence of electromagnetic disturbances. This
could result in issues such as error messages or the failure of the display/device.
• Avoid using this device directly next to other devices or stacked on top of other devices,
as this could lead to faulty operation. If, however, it is necessary to use the device in the
manner stated, this device as well as the other devices must be monitored to ensure they
are working properly.
